Learn about CVE-2021-4079, a critical out-of-bounds write vulnerability in Google Chrome versions prior to 96.0.4664.93 allowing remote attackers to trigger heap corruption.
This article provides an overview of CVE-2021-4079, a vulnerability in Google Chrome that allowed for a remote attacker to exploit heap corruption via crafted WebRTC packets.
Understanding CVE-2021-4079
In this section, we will delve into the details of the CVE-2021-4079 vulnerability.
What is CVE-2021-4079?
The CVE-2021-4079 vulnerability involved an out-of-bounds write issue in WebRTC in Google Chrome versions prior to 96.0.4664.93. This flaw could be exploited by a remote attacker to potentially trigger heap corruption through maliciously crafted WebRTC packets.
The Impact of CVE-2021-4079
The impact of CVE-2021-4079 was significant as it could allow an attacker to execute arbitrary code, leading to potential system compromise and unauthorized access to sensitive information.
Technical Details of CVE-2021-4079
This section will discuss the technical aspects of the CVE-2021-4079 vulnerability.
Vulnerability Description
The vulnerability was categorized as an out-of-bounds write issue in WebRTC, posing a serious security risk to affected versions of Google Chrome.
Affected Systems and Versions
Google Chrome versions prior to 96.0.4664.93 were affected by CVE-2021-4079, leaving users of these versions vulnerable to potential exploitation.
Exploitation Mechanism
Exploiting this vulnerability involved sending specially crafted WebRTC packets to the target system, triggering the out-of-bounds write condition and potentially leading to heap corruption.
Mitigation and Prevention
In this section, we will cover the steps to mitigate and prevent exploitation of CVE-2021-4079.
Immediate Steps to Take
Users were advised to update Google Chrome to version 96.0.4664.93 or later to mitigate the CVE-2021-4079 vulnerability and prevent potential attacks.
Long-Term Security Practices
Practicing good security hygiene, such as regularly updating software and exercising caution while browsing the web, can help prevent future vulnerabilities and attacks.
Patching and Updates
It is crucial for users to stay informed about security updates and promptly apply patches released by vendors to address known vulnerabilities and enhance the security of their systems.